Output 27ae81e541014f37c30ca93d4cf96a3077292b4bd363aa215e26c3fc517e9d85:0

value
528592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0813de43d2ce6d16234475030549656c6d4e0a90 OP_EQUAL
address
32Rj8YfKdtSqb7Xx7Ue3faYuqc2LjuDw1M
transaction
27ae81e541014f37c30ca93d4cf96a3077292b4bd363aa215e26c3fc517e9d85
spent
true